Synthesis of Branched Alkylboronates by Copper‐Catalyzed Allylic Substitution Reactions of Allylic Chlorides with 1,1‐Diborylalkanes |

Abstract: | Reported herein is a copper‐catalyzed SN2′‐selective allylic substitution reaction using readily accessible allylic chlorides and 1,1‐diborylalkanes, a reaction which proceeds with chemoselective C?B bond activation of the 1,1‐diborylalkanes. In the presence of a catalytic amount of [Cu(IMes)Cl] [IMes=1,3‐bis(2,4,6‐trimethylphenyl)imidazole‐2‐ylidene] and LiOtBu as a base, a range of primary and secondary allylic chlorides undergo the SN2′‐selective allylic substitution reaction to produce branched alkylboronates. The synthetic utilities of the obtained alkylboronates are also presented. |
